Judson College vs. UALR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Judson College or UALR?

  • Judson College is 200.9% more expensive to attend than UALR for in-state tuition ($17,240.00 vs. $5,729.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 5.6% higher at Judson College than University of Arkansas at Little Rock ($17,240.00 vs. $16,320.00)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at University of Arkansas at Little Rock are 24.2% lower than costs at Judson College ($9,162 vs. $11,380)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at University of Arkansas at Little Rock than Judson College (92% vs. 0%)

Judson College vs. UALR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Judson College or UALR?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between UALR and Judson College.

  • The graduation rate at Judson College is higher than University of Arkansas at Little Rock (38% vs. 21%)
  • Graduates from University of Arkansas at Little Rock earn on average $6,400 more per year than Judson College graduates after ten years. ($38,000 vs. $31,600)
  • More UALR gra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Judson College students, three years after graduation. (51% vs. 48%)
